Can't say I really "like" one better than the other, I know ADP far better and well enough to know that in all reality just about all the DMS being offered to the dealers suck. Each one just sucks in it's own way, and as you get more used to them they each have certain areas that they do better or worse.
Have you ever showed anyone from another industry the software we are expected to manage our inventory with? I have and they laughed. Whether it be ADP, Reynolds or Dealertrack they are all extremely archaic. All of them are just GUI's on the front of old and tired code. Someday someone is going to start from scratch and blow us all away with real software.
Hang in there, it will get easier. I actually hate Dealertrack a lot less than I used to. Maybe someday they will even get me the report writer and I will say something nice about them .

I know Im a little late on this one! What I tell my clients when it comes to transition from one DMS to another is 1) Attitude is everything! Your employees will feed from your attitude so if you hate it they will too, and that will hurt more than help. 2) You really wont be able to speak intelligently about the DMS at least until for a few months, so hold those preemptive thoughts because what you believe to be facts will change as you start to truly understand the DMS and all of its functions. 3) The real issue is CHANGE! No one likes it, and rarely do they embrace it! Blame most of the issues to change, and realize it will get better as time goes on.
